Section 1 Overview
Food presentation encompasses how food is prepared, arranged, and offered to your bird, profoundly influencing dietary acceptance and nutritional intake far beyond what many bird owners realize. The same nutritious vegetable offered whole versus chopped, raw versus cooked, or alone versus mixed with other ingredients can elicit entirely different responses from your bird. Understanding and strategically applying food presentation principles helps bird owners overcome common feeding challenges, encourage consumption of nutritious foods that birds might otherwise ignore, and create more engaging mealtime experiences that support both physical and psychological health.
Many companion birds develop strong preferences for specific foods while refusing to try new items or avoiding nutritious options that should form part of a balanced diet. These feeding challenges often relate more to presentation than to the foods themselves. A bird that rejects whole carrots might enthusiastically consume the same carrot when shredded, and one that ignores pellets in a bowl might eat them when incorporated into a foraging opportunity. Rather than accepting food rejection as an unchangeable preference, bird owners can employ presentation strategies that transform rejected foods into accepted ones, dramatically improving dietary quality and nutritional balance.
The visual appeal of food matters significantly to birds, who possess excellent color vision and naturally evaluate potential food sources partly based on appearance. Bright colors attract attention, while dull or unfamiliar appearances may trigger neophobia, the fear of new things that protects wild birds from consuming potentially dangerous items but causes companion birds to reject nutritious unfamiliar foods. Understanding how birds perceive food visually allows owners to present foods in ways that attract rather than deter interest, using color, texture, and arrangement strategically to encourage consumption of healthy options.
Beyond visual factors, the physical form in which food is offered affects whether birds can easily consume it and whether eating that food provides the behavioral satisfaction birds seek from foraging. Foods requiring manipulation engage birds more fully than foods requiring no effort, providing enrichment value alongside nutrition. Different bird species evolved with different food processing abilities, meaning the ideal presentation varies based on beak shape, size, and natural foraging behaviors. What works perfectly for one species may be entirely inappropriate for another, making species-specific presentation knowledge valuable for bird owners.

Section 2 Detailed Information
The science of avian vision provides important context for understanding how birds perceive food presentation. Birds possess tetrachromatic vision with four types of color receptors compared to humans' three, allowing them to perceive a broader color spectrum including ultraviolet wavelengths invisible to human eyes. This superior color vision means birds evaluate food appearance differently than humans might expect. Colors that appear similar to human eyes may look distinctly different to birds, and ultraviolet reflectance patterns on foods influence bird perception in ways we cannot directly observe. Fruits and vegetables naturally produce ultraviolet signals that attract bird attention, explaining why these foods often appeal to birds when presented fresh and colorful.
Neophobia, the fear of novelty, represents one of the most significant barriers to dietary acceptance in companion birds and directly relates to food presentation. Wild birds must exercise caution about consuming unfamiliar items that might be toxic or harmful, and this protective instinct persists strongly in captive birds. New foods, new presentations, even familiar foods in new dishes can trigger neophobic responses causing birds to avoid items they would otherwise enjoy. Understanding neophobia helps owners implement gradual presentation changes that overcome fear responses rather than reinforcing avoidance through repeated rejection experiences. Patience and systematic desensitization prove essential when introducing presentation changes to neophobic birds.
Food size and shape significantly impact whether birds can and will consume particular items. Offering whole foods that exceed a bird's comfortable manipulation range often results in rejection not because the bird dislikes the food but because eating it presents too great a challenge. Conversely, foods chopped too finely may not provide the behavioral satisfaction birds derive from food manipulation, reducing interest despite easy accessibility. The optimal size allows birds to hold, manipulate, and process food items in ways that feel natural and engaging. This optimal size varies by species, with larger parrots preferring substantial pieces they can hold in their feet while smaller birds need proportionately scaled portions they can manage with their beaks alone.
Texture preferences vary among individual birds and species, affecting which food forms generate the most acceptance. Some birds prefer crunchy raw vegetables while others favor softer cooked preparations. Certain individuals enjoy smooth purees while others want foods with distinct textural elements they can process separately. Seeds with hulls provide different eating experiences than hulled seeds, and sprouted seeds offer yet another textural variation. Exploring different textures helps identify individual preferences that maximize consumption of nutritious foods. When a bird rejects a food in one texture, offering alternate preparations may reveal previously undiscovered acceptance.
The arrangement and combination of foods within feeding dishes influences consumption patterns and nutritional balance. When all foods are mixed together, birds can easily sort through to extract preferred items while ignoring less favored but nutritionally important components. Separating foods into distinct compartments or dishes prevents this selective feeding but may overwhelm birds with too many choices. Strategic mixing can also work advantageously, combining highly preferred foods with nutritious items birds tend to avoid, creating associations that increase consumption of the latter. Understanding your bird's feeding behaviors helps determine whether mixing, separating, or strategically combining foods produces the best results.
The freshness and quality of food presentation directly affects acceptance and provides food safety benefits. Fresh foods with vibrant colors, firm textures, and natural appearance attract birds more than wilted, discolored, or deteriorating items that signal spoilage. Birds evolved to avoid foods showing signs of decay that might cause illness, so suboptimal freshness triggers innate avoidance responses. Presenting the freshest possible foods at optimal temperatures enhances appeal while ensuring food safety. Morning feeding of fresh items when birds are most hungry and active maximizes consumption before food quality declines throughout the day.
Section 3 Safety And Guidelines
Safe food preparation practices must accompany all presentation strategies to ensure that creatively offered foods do not compromise your bird's health. All cutting boards, knives, and preparation surfaces should be thoroughly cleaned before preparing bird foods, particularly when the same surfaces are used for human food preparation involving raw meat, poultry, or fish that could harbor bacteria dangerous to birds. Dedicated bird food preparation equipment eliminates cross-contamination concerns entirely. Wash hands thoroughly before handling bird food, and ensure all fresh produce is rinsed to remove pesticide residues, dirt, and potential contaminants before presentation to your bird.
Temperature considerations apply to food presentation in multiple ways affecting both safety and acceptance. Hot foods can burn a bird's sensitive crop and mouth, causing serious injury that may not be immediately apparent. Allow cooked foods to cool to room temperature or slightly warm before offering. At the opposite extreme, very cold foods may be less appealing and can cause digestive discomfort in some birds. Foods stored in the refrigerator should generally come to room temperature before presentation unless your particular bird shows preference for cooler items. During warm weather, monitor how quickly fresh foods deteriorate at room temperature and adjust presentation timing accordingly.
Certain preparation methods that appeal to humans can create dangers for birds and should be avoided entirely. Never add salt, sugar, oils, or seasonings to foods being prepared for birds, as these additions can cause health problems ranging from digestive upset to serious toxicity. Cooking methods involving non-stick surfaces coated with PTFE (Teflon) pose lethal risks to birds if overheated, so prepare bird foods using stainless steel, ceramic, or other bird-safe cookware. Fried foods contain unhealthy fats inappropriate for bird nutrition regardless of how appealing the presentation might be. Keep bird food preparation simple and free of additives designed for human palates.
When presenting foods on branches, skewers, or other holders, ensure all materials are bird-safe and free from toxic treatments or finishes. Natural branches should come from trees known to be safe for birds and must not have been treated with pesticides, herbicides, or other chemicals. Stainless steel skewers designed for bird use are preferable to wooden skewers that may splinter or plastic alternatives that birds might ingest. Any holder or presentation device should be examined for sharp edges, points, or small parts that could cause injury or be swallowed. The presentation method should never introduce hazards that outweigh the enrichment benefits.
Monitoring consumption remains essential when implementing new presentation strategies, particularly with birds being encouraged to try new foods or presentations. Ensure birds actually consume adequate nutrition rather than simply playing with creatively presented foods without eating them. Some presentation methods generate more waste than consumption, which may be acceptable occasionally for enrichment purposes but should not become the standard if nutritional intake suffers. Track approximate consumption by comparing food offered to food remaining, and weigh birds regularly to ensure body condition remains stable throughout any dietary or presentation transitions.
Section 4 Practical Advice
Implementing effective food presentation begins with observing your bird's current eating behaviors and preferences to establish a baseline for improvement. Note which foods your bird eagerly consumes versus ignores, how they manipulate different food forms, whether they prefer certain colors or textures, and how they respond to food presented in different ways. This observation period provides valuable information for designing presentation strategies tailored to your individual bird's tendencies. A bird that immediately attacks large food items requires different presentation approaches than one that seems intimidated by substantial pieces, and a bird attracted to bright colors benefits from different strategies than one showing less color-based selectivity.
Varying cutting methods for vegetables and fruits dramatically expands presentation options using the same nutritious ingredients. A single carrot can be offered whole, sliced into coins, cut into sticks, julienned into thin strips, shredded finely, or grated into tiny pieces. Each presentation creates a different visual appearance, requires different manipulation to eat, and may appeal to different individual preferences. Similarly, leafy greens can be offered as whole leaves for tearing, chopped, or rolled around other foods. Experimenting with various cutting methods for foods your bird currently rejects sometimes reveals presentations that overcome previous resistance.
Food combination strategies can increase acceptance of nutritious but less-preferred items by association with highly preferred foods. Mixing small amounts of vegetables into warm, moist grain dishes or birdie bread creates presentations where birds consuming preferred items incidentally eat nutritious additions. Threading alternating chunks of preferred and less-preferred foods on skewers encourages sequential consumption as birds work along the length. Topping favorite foods with finely chopped vegetables incorporates nutrition into already-accepted items. These combination approaches work best with subtle proportions that do not overwhelm preferred foods, gradually increasing nutritious additions as acceptance develops.
Creating food presentation stations throughout your bird's environment expands presentation opportunities beyond traditional food dishes. Hang food skewers at various heights, weave leafy greens through cage bars, place food items in foraging toys, and position different presentations in different locations. This environmental distribution of varied presentations transforms feeding time into an extended exploration activity while providing multiple opportunities for your bird to encounter nutritious foods presented in appealing ways. Different stations can feature different presentation styles, allowing comparison of which approaches generate the most engagement and consumption.
Developing a rotation schedule for presentation methods prevents habituation and maintains ongoing interest in food offerings. Birds may initially respond enthusiastically to a novel presentation method only to lose interest as novelty fades. Rotating through multiple presentation approaches keeps feeding experiences varied and engaging over time. Document which presentations work well for your bird and incorporate them into a rotating schedule that ensures no single approach becomes so routine that it loses appeal. This rotation system also provides ongoing opportunities to retest presentations that were previously rejected, as bird preferences may shift over time.
Section 5 Species Considerations
Large parrots including macaws, cockatoos, and Amazon parrots possess powerful beaks capable of processing large, hard food items and benefit from presentations that utilize these natural abilities. These species enjoy holding substantial food pieces in their feet while manipulating them with their beaks, so presentations featuring large chunks, whole vegetables, or foods on branches that require destruction to access appeal to their natural foraging style. Macaws particularly appreciate nuts in shell that challenge their impressive cracking abilities. Cockatoos enjoy presentations requiring shredding and destruction of materials to reach food rewards. Amazons benefit from presentations featuring the bright colors that attract their visual attention and foods requiring manipulation that occupies their active minds.
Medium parrots such as African Greys, conures, Eclectus parrots, and cockatiels each have presentation preferences reflecting their natural foraging adaptations and individual species characteristics. African Greys are thoughtful, observant eaters that appreciate consistent presentation patterns they can learn while still requiring variety to maintain interest; they often prefer methodical eating experiences over chaotic presentations. Conures enjoy playful presentations incorporating movement and requiring acrobatic access, reflecting their active personalities. Eclectus parrots, with their specialized digestive systems and fresh food emphasis, respond particularly well to attractive presentations of colorful vegetables and fruits. Cockatiels, as smaller members of the cockatoo family, enjoy presentations allowing food manipulation but sized appropriately for their moderate beak strength.
Small birds including budgies, finches, canaries, and parrotlets require presentations scaled to their diminutive size and beak capabilities. Food pieces must be small enough for tiny beaks to manage effectively, and presentation devices must be proportionate to small bird dimensions. Budgies enjoy spray millet and seeding grasses presented on stems that allow natural picking behavior, as well as finely chopped vegetables mixed into seed presentations. Finches and canaries prefer very small food pieces appropriate to their delicate beaks, with seeding grasses and finely grated vegetables proving popular. Parrotlets, despite their tiny size, are confident manipulators that enjoy presentation challenges appropriate to their small scale.
Softbill species have evolved specialized feeding adaptations requiring tailored presentation approaches distinct from parrot-focused strategies. Fruit-eating softbills appreciate ripe fruits presented at optimal freshness with vibrant color indicating palatability. Slicing fruits to reveal interior color and juiciness increases appeal for these visually-oriented feeders. Nectar-feeding species require liquid presentations in appropriate feeders that accommodate their specialized tongues. Insectivorous softbills respond to movement, so live insects or presentations that incorporate motion trigger feeding responses more effectively than static food presentations. Understanding the specific dietary niche of your softbill species guides appropriate presentation decisions that align with evolutionary feeding adaptations.
Section 6 Key Takeaways
Food presentation significantly influences dietary acceptance and nutritional intake in companion birds, often determining whether nutritious foods are consumed or ignored. The same food offered in different forms, sizes, colors, and arrangements can generate entirely different responses from your bird. Understanding presentation principles empowers bird owners to overcome common feeding challenges, encourage acceptance of nutritious foods birds might otherwise reject, and create more engaging mealtime experiences that support health and wellbeing. Rather than accepting food preferences as fixed, strategic presentation provides tools for positive dietary change.
Birds evaluate food based on visual appearance, size, texture, and form, with excellent color vision playing a particularly important role in food assessment. Neophobia causes many birds to initially reject new foods or presentations regardless of actual palatability, requiring patient, gradual introduction strategies to overcome. Optimal food size varies by species and individual, with presentations that allow natural manipulation and processing generating greater interest than forms that are too large to handle or too small to provide behavioral satisfaction.
Safe food presentation practices must accompany all creative presentation strategies. Ensure preparation surfaces, equipment, and hands are clean before handling bird food. Allow cooked foods to cool appropriately before offering, and never add seasonings, salt, sugar, or oils to bird foods. Use only bird-safe materials for presentation devices like skewers and holders, avoiding toxic treatments and potential hazards. Monitor actual consumption to verify that creative presentations translate to adequate nutritional intake.
Implementing effective presentation strategies begins with observing your bird's current preferences and behaviors, then systematically experimenting with variations in cutting methods, food combinations, presentation locations, and serving styles. Rotate presentation methods to maintain novelty and interest over time, and document what works well for your individual bird. With consistent application of thoughtful presentation principles, bird owners can significantly improve their birds' dietary variety and nutritional quality while enhancing the enrichment value of daily feeding experiences.
